## Formula sandbox tuning

User-supplied formulas in Gridmoor execute inside a restricted interpreter with hard ceilings on time, memory, and call depth. Reviewers should confirm any change to these ceilings is justified in the PR description, since raising them widens the abuse surface. Defaults were chosen from production traces. The current limits are as follows.

limits module of tafog-fawip:
WEIGHTS = {
    "julix": 57,
    "lamys": 992,
    "kasvan": 209,
    "quenok": 750,
    "alddor": 259,
    "oliath": 1009,
    "wenix": 815,
}

## Auth for partition jobs

The Monthwise partitioner rolls tables over on the 1st, and the rollover job hits the Ledgerloom admin API to create next month's partition. That API won't take service-account creds anymore — it wants a bearer token on every call. For the demo at Thursday's sync, use the token below.

session JWT of yawep-yawep = eyJhbGciOiJIUzI1NiIsInR5cCI6IkpXVCJ9.eyJzdWIiOiI3pWF3_In0.aXYsHiog

Insurance Renewal — Managers' Wiki (Restricted)

Welcome aboard! Quick context for the incoming director: our commercial policy with Ashgrove Mutual renews at the end of Q2. Premiums are up about 9% due to the warehouse claim at the Bellmont site last year. We've shopped quotes from two other carriers; Ashgrove still wins on coverage breadth. Decision needed by mid-May. The confidential summary of related business plans sits just below.

board note of fahag-tajop: The eastern region missed its Julix quota by 44.0 percent last quarter. Ralionax Holdings plans to lower the Druath list price by 61.8 percent in March. The board signed off on a budget of $295.0 million for Project Gilath. The renewal with Ruswynix Systems closes at $274.5 million a year, 17.0 percent above the last contract.